About 11 Barnstead Avenue

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

11 Barnstead Avenue is a mid-terrace house in Manchester (M20 4UL). It has a recorded floor area of 93 m² (around 1001 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(January 2015)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 76). The latest certificate is from January 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

At 93 m² it's 22.4% larger than the typical home in the postcode (76 m² median across 19 EPCs). It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 74% of similar EPCs). One historical planning record sits against the property in 2023.
